Singapore Airlines introduces Internet seat selection

Airline Industry Information, Nov 2, 2004

AIRLINE INDUSTRY INFORMATION-(C)1997-2004 M2 COMMUNICATIONS LTD

Singapore Airlines has launched a new system which will allow almost all its passengers to ask for certain seats when checking in via the Internet.

The airline said that passengers checking in on its website can pick a seat from an interactive seat map and then receive confirmation through an SMS text message or an e-mail. Frequent flyers will also be able to change their seats or cancel their check-in.

The service is available on all Singapore Airlines flights except certain services from India and some other Asian cities. A spokesperson for the airline said that the new suite of tools is designed to improve customers' pre-flight experience, reports AFP.
